Mather Heights, Green Bay, WI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mather Heights?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mather Heights Studio Apartments | $1,412 | $749 | $1,670 |
| Mather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,486 | $513 | $2,380 |
| Mather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,905 | $617 | $5,995 |
| Mather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,773 | $790 | $3,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Mather Heights Apartments
What is a cheap apartment in Mather Heights?
A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Mather Heights is under $895.
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Mather Heights?
The cheapest apartment in Mather Heights is Moraine Court which is listed at $750, while the average apartment in Mather Heights costs $1,600.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Mather Heights?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 24 regular apartments in Mather Heights that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
